What is a limiting value?
a. a value to which a function f(x) approaches as closely as desired as the independent variable approaches a specified value (x = a) or approaches infinity. b. a value to which a sequence an approaches arbitrarily close as n approaches infinity.
Does the ln of 0 exist?
What is the natural logarithm of zero? The real natural logarithm function ln(x) is defined only for x>0. So the natural logarithm of zero is undefined.

Which is the best definition of rate of return?
This simple rate of return is sometimes called the basic growth rate, or alternatively, return on investment (ROI). If you also consider the effect of the time value of money and inflation, the real rate of return can also be defined as the net amount of discounted cash flows (DCF) received on an investment after adjusting for inflation.
